Essential Experience Highlights for a Strong Lead Caster Resume

Here are a few key responsibilities/highlights that you can consider to include in your experience section while creating a Lead Caster resume that can significantly enhance your resume’s impact.
  • Manage and oversee all aspects of casting operations, including mold making, core making, melting, and pouring
  • Develop and implement casting processes to meet customer specifications and industry standards
  • Train and supervise casting technicians to ensure proper operation of equipment and adherence to safety protocols
  • Monitor and maintain casting equipment to ensure optimal performance and prevent downtime
  • Troubleshoot casting defects and implement corrective actions to minimize waste and improve product quality

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Lead Caster

  • What is the primary role of a Lead Caster?

    The primary role of a Lead Caster is to manage and oversee all aspects of casting operations, ensuring adherence to quality standards and safety protocols.

  • What are the key skills and qualifications required for a Lead Caster?

    Key skills and qualifications include expertise in various casting techniques, knowledge of casting materials and processes, proficiency in managing and training casting teams, and a strong commitment to quality and safety.

  • What are the career prospects for Lead Casters?

    Lead Casters with experience and expertise can advance to roles such as Casting Supervisor, Production Manager, or Quality Control Manager.

  • How can I prepare to become a successful Lead Caster?

    To prepare for a successful career as a Lead Caster, consider pursuing a deg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related field, gaining practical experience through internships or apprenticeships, and staying up-to-date on the latest casting technologies and industry best practices.

  • What are the common challenges faced by Lead Casters?

    Common challenges include managing production schedules, ensuring adherence to quality standards, troubleshooting casting defects, and maintaining a safe and efficient work environment.

  • What qualities make a great Lead Caster?

    Great Lead Casters possess strong leadership skills, technical expertise, a commitment to quality, and a focus on continuous improvement.
